If a Survivor is left in the Dying State for a total of 90 seconds during a match, they gain the ability to pick themselves up after fully recovering.
emphasis mine
'gain the ability' implies permanence in the game's parlance

They still have to recover, which is a 32 second action, and still bleed our at 4 minutes.
So the first time is 90 seconds, then another 32 after that, up to 4 minutes tops.
But honestly, what is the killer doing that leaving someone slugged for 90 seconds is the answer besides intentionally slugging?
Killer is supposedly all about "being efficient with your time", so if you're taking the entire length of a gen to close out a second chase, then you're really, really doing something wrong on your end. Especially since the average, total match chase time is about 60 seconds per survivor.
